La Isla and Gobiendes

Wednesday:-

We arrived in La Isla on Tuesday and found our hotel which was by the beach. On Wednesday morning we walked up to the headland and found the trenches, now restored, a sobering reminder of the Civil War. Then in the afternoon we went to Gobiendes to visit the pre Romanesque church.

Santiago de Gobiendes is only open on the first Wednesday of the month from 2.00pm and you have to either phone or arrive at the nearby Sueve Museum before then. The guided tour was very interesting and this is a good place to visit, just off the Camino del Norte.

Following the suggestion made by the guide we then walked from Gobiendes to Obayu and back along a lovely forest track. This leads to a waterfall and 'fuente' (fountain) and in Gobiendes itself also passes the walk around the local hórreos.

Spain 2016

After nearly 5 weeks in N Spain we are now home again. Our plans to walk or take the car various places of interest along the northern Caminos were added to and we have visited some amazing places. Once our photos are sorted we will add posts along the Camino del Norte, the Ruta do Mar, the Camino Primitivo and also the mountain area around Cangas del Narcea. This last is not on the Camino but in the national park. Finally we visited the Picos de Europa and the lakes at Covadonga before returning to Santander via Cabezon de la Sal.
